![JAR search and dependency download from the Maven repository](/logo.png)
com.google.common.collect.ImmutableSortedSet.class Maven / Gradle / Ivy
???? 4?<=
>?
@A
BC DE
?F
G
?HI
J
KL
MN ?
O
P
QR
S
T
U
VW
XYZ
[
\]
X^
?_
?`
a
bc
de ?f
dg
?h
ij k
l
Gm
n
o
p
Vq
r
s
t
u
vw
\x
y
z{|
5m }
~
?
9???
<??
?
??
G?
?
?
?
???? SerializedForm InnerClasses Builder SPLITERATOR_CHARACTERISTICS I
ConstantValue
comparator Ljava/util/Comparator; Signature Ljava/util/Comparator<-TE;>;
descendingSet .Lcom/google/common/collect/ImmutableSortedSet; 3Lcom/google/common/collect/ImmutableSortedSet; RuntimeVisibleAnnotations 7Lcom/google/errorprone/annotations/concurrent/LazyInit; Ljavax/annotation/CheckForNull; RuntimeInvisibleAnnotations /Lcom/google/common/annotations/GwtIncompatible; serialVersionUID J???????? toImmutableSortedSet 4(Ljava/util/Comparator;)Ljava/util/stream/Collector; Code LineNumberTable LocalVariableTable LocalVariableTypeTable MethodParameters ?(Ljava/util/Comparator<-TE;>;)Ljava/util/stream/Collector;>; emptySet M(Ljava/util/Comparator;)Lcom/google/common/collect/RegularImmutableSortedSet; result 5Lcom/google/common/collect/RegularImmutableSortedSet; :Lcom/google/common/collect/RegularImmutableSortedSet;
StackMapTable n(Ljava/util/Comparator<-TE;>;)Lcom/google/common/collect/RegularImmutableSortedSet; of 0()Lcom/google/common/collect/ImmutableSortedSet; K()Lcom/google/common/collect/ImmutableSortedSet; F(Ljava/lang/Comparable;)Lcom/google/common/collect/ImmutableSortedSet; e1 Ljava/lang/Comparable; TE; Y;>(TE;)Lcom/google/common/collect/ImmutableSortedSet; \(Ljava/lang/Comparable;Ljava/lang/Comparable;)Lcom/google/common/collect/ImmutableSortedSet; e2 \;>(TE;TE;)Lcom/google/common/collect/ImmutableSortedSet; r(Ljava/lang/Comparable;Ljava/lang/Comparable;Ljava/lang/Comparable;)Lcom/google/common/collect/ImmutableSortedSet; e3 _;>(TE;TE;TE;)Lcom/google/common/collect/ImmutableSortedSet; ?(Ljava/lang/Comparable;Ljava/lang/Comparable;Ljava/lang/Comparable;Ljava/lang/Comparable;)Lcom/google/common/collect/ImmutableSortedSet; e4 b;>(TE;TE;TE;TE;)Lcom/google/common/collect/ImmutableSortedSet; ?(Ljava/lang/Comparable;Ljava/lang/Comparable;Ljava/lang/Comparable;Ljava/lang/Comparable;Ljava/lang/Comparable;)Lcom/google/common/collect/ImmutableSortedSet; e5 e;>(TE;TE;TE;TE;TE;)Lcom/google/common/collect/ImmutableSortedSet; ?(Ljava/lang/Comparable;Ljava/lang/Comparable;Ljava/lang/Comparable;Ljava/lang/Comparable;Ljava/lang/Comparable;Ljava/lang/Comparable;[Ljava/lang/Comparable;)Lcom/google/common/collect/ImmutableSortedSet; e6 remaining [Ljava/lang/Comparable; contents [TE; [Ljava/lang/Comparable<*>; l;>(TE;TE;TE;TE;TE;TE;[TE;)Lcom/google/common/collect/ImmutableSortedSet; copyOf G([Ljava/lang/Comparable;)Lcom/google/common/collect/ImmutableSortedSet; elements Z;>([TE;)Lcom/google/common/collect/ImmutableSortedSet; D(Ljava/lang/Iterable;)Lcom/google/common/collect/ImmutableSortedSet; Ljava/lang/Iterable; naturalOrder $Lcom/google/common/collect/Ordering; Ljava/lang/Iterable<+TE;>; )Lcom/google/common/collect/Ordering; e(Ljava/lang/Iterable<+TE;>;)Lcom/google/common/collect/ImmutableSortedSet; F(Ljava/util/Collection;)Lcom/google/common/collect/ImmutableSortedSet; Ljava/util/Collection; Ljava/util/Collection<+TE;>; g(Ljava/util/Collection<+TE;>;)Lcom/google/common/collect/ImmutableSortedSet; D(Ljava/util/Iterator;)Lcom/google/common/collect/ImmutableSortedSet; Ljava/util/Iterator; Ljava/util/Iterator<+TE;>; e(Ljava/util/Iterator<+TE;>;)Lcom/google/common/collect/ImmutableSortedSet; Z(Ljava/util/Comparator;Ljava/util/Iterator;)Lcom/google/common/collect/ImmutableSortedSet; ?(Ljava/util/Comparator<-TE;>;Ljava/util/Iterator<+TE;>;)Lcom/google/common/collect/ImmutableSortedSet; Z(Ljava/util/Comparator;Ljava/lang/Iterable;)Lcom/google/common/collect/ImmutableSortedSet; original hasSameComparator Z array [Ljava/lang/Object; ?(Ljava/util/Comparator<-TE;>;Ljava/lang/Iterable<+TE;>;)Lcom/google/common/collect/ImmutableSortedSet; \(Ljava/util/Comparator;Ljava/util/Collection;)Lcom/google/common/collect/ImmutableSortedSet; ?(Ljava/util/Comparator<-TE;>;Ljava/util/Collection<+TE;>;)Lcom/google/common/collect/ImmutableSortedSet; copyOfSorted E(Ljava/util/SortedSet;)Lcom/google/common/collect/ImmutableSortedSet; sortedSet Ljava/util/SortedSet; list )Lcom/google/common/collect/ImmutableList; Ljava/util/SortedSet; .Lcom/google/common/collect/ImmutableList;?? e(Ljava/util/SortedSet;)Lcom/google/common/collect/ImmutableSortedSet; construct Z(Ljava/util/Comparator;I[Ljava/lang/Object;)Lcom/google/common/collect/ImmutableSortedSet; cur Ljava/lang/Object; prev i n uniques l(Ljava/util/Comparator<-TE;>;I[TE;)Lcom/google/common/collect/ImmutableSortedSet; orderedBy N(Ljava/util/Comparator;)Lcom/google/common/collect/ImmutableSortedSet$Builder; Ljava/util/Comparator; n(Ljava/util/Comparator;)Lcom/google/common/collect/ImmutableSortedSet$Builder; reverseOrder 8()Lcom/google/common/collect/ImmutableSortedSet$Builder; [;>()Lcom/google/common/collect/ImmutableSortedSet$Builder;
unsafeCompare '(Ljava/lang/Object;Ljava/lang/Object;)I this a b "RuntimeVisibleParameterAnnotations =(Ljava/util/Comparator;Ljava/lang/Object;Ljava/lang/Object;)I unsafeComparator Ljava/util/Comparator<*>; *Ljava/util/Comparator; RuntimeVisibleTypeAnnotations 5Lorg/checkerframework/checker/nullness/qual/Nullable; @(Ljava/util/Comparator<*>;Ljava/lang/Object;Ljava/lang/Object;)I (Ljava/util/Comparator;)V (Ljava/util/Comparator<-TE;>;)V ()Ljava/util/Comparator; ()Ljava/util/Comparator<-TE;>; iterator 2()Lcom/google/common/collect/UnmodifiableIterator; 7()Lcom/google/common/collect/UnmodifiableIterator; headSet B(Ljava/lang/Object;)Lcom/google/common/collect/ImmutableSortedSet; toElement 8(TE;)Lcom/google/common/collect/ImmutableSortedSet; C(Ljava/lang/Object;Z)Lcom/google/common/collect/ImmutableSortedSet; inclusive 9(TE;Z)Lcom/google/common/collect/ImmutableSortedSet; subSet T(Ljava/lang/Object;Ljava/lang/Object;)Lcom/google/common/collect/ImmutableSortedSet; fromElement ;(TE;TE;)Lcom/google/common/collect/ImmutableSortedSet; V(Ljava/lang/Object;ZLjava/lang/Object;Z)Lcom/google/common/collect/ImmutableSortedSet;
fromInclusive toInclusive =(TE;ZTE;Z)Lcom/google/common/collect/ImmutableSortedSet; tailSet headSetImpl
subSetImpl tailSetImpl lower &(Ljava/lang/Object;)Ljava/lang/Object; e (TE;)TE; floor ceiling higher first ()Ljava/lang/Object; ()TE; last pollFirst
Deprecated Ljava/lang/Deprecated; 8Lcom/google/errorprone/annotations/CanIgnoreReturnValue; -Lcom/google/errorprone/annotations/DoNotCall; value +Always throws UnsupportedOperationException pollLast 5()Lcom/google/common/collect/ImmutableSortedSet; createDescendingSet spliterator ()Ljava/util/Spliterator; ()Ljava/util/Spliterator; descendingIterator indexOf (Ljava/lang/Object;)I target
readObject (Ljava/io/ObjectInputStream;)V unused Ljava/io/ObjectInputStream;
Exceptions 0Lcom/google/common/annotations/J2ktIncompatible; writeReplace toImmutableSet ()Ljava/util/stream/Collector; g()Ljava/util/stream/Collector;>; Use toImmutableSortedSet builder S()Lcom/google/common/collect/ImmutableSortedSet$Builder; Use naturalOrder builderWithExpectedSize 9(I)Lcom/google/common/collect/ImmutableSortedSet$Builder; expectedSize T(I)Lcom/google/common/collect/ImmutableSortedSet$Builder; 9Use naturalOrder (which does not accept an expected size) N(TE;)Lcom/google/common/collect/ImmutableSortedSet; #Pass a parameter of type Comparable Q(TE;TE;)Lcom/google/common/collect/ImmutableSortedSet; "Pass parameters of type Comparable f(Ljava/lang/Object;Ljava/lang/Object;Ljava/lang/Object;)Lcom/google/common/collect/ImmutableSortedSet; T(TE;TE;TE;)Lcom/google/common/collect/ImmutableSortedSet; x(Ljava/lang/Object;Ljava/lang/Object;Ljava/lang/Object;Ljava/lang/Object;)Lcom/google/common/collect/ImmutableSortedSet; W(TE;TE;TE;TE;)Lcom/google/common/collect/ImmutableSortedSet; ?(Ljava/lang/Object;Ljava/lang/Object;Ljava/lang/Object;Ljava/lang/Object;Ljava/lang/Object;)Lcom/google/common/collect/ImmutableSortedSet; Z(TE;TE;TE;TE;TE;)Lcom/google/common/collect/ImmutableSortedSet; ?(Ljava/lang/Object;Ljava/lang/Object;Ljava/lang/Object;Ljava/lang/Object;Ljava/lang/Object;Ljava/lang/Object;[Ljava/lang/Object;)Lcom/google/common/collect/ImmutableSortedSet; a(TE;TE;TE;TE;TE;TE;[TE;)Lcom/google/common/collect/ImmutableSortedSet; C([Ljava/lang/Object;)Lcom/google/common/collect/ImmutableSortedSet; [TZ; O([TZ;)Lcom/google/common/collect/ImmutableSortedSet; asList +()Lcom/google/common/collect/ImmutableList; ()Ljava/util/Iterator; )(Ljava/lang/Object;)Ljava/util/SortedSet; ;(Ljava/lang/Object;Ljava/lang/Object;)Ljava/util/SortedSet; -(Ljava/lang/Object;Z)Ljava/util/NavigableSet; @(Ljava/lang/Object;ZLjava/lang/Object;Z)Ljava/util/NavigableSet; ()Ljava/util/NavigableSet;
CachingAsList ?Lcom/google/common/collect/ImmutableSet$CachingAsList;Ljava/util/NavigableSet;Lcom/google/common/collect/SortedIterable;
SourceFile ImmutableSortedSet.java ;Lcom/google/common/collect/ElementTypesAreNonnullByDefault; -Lcom/google/common/annotations/GwtCompatible; serializable emulated &com/google/common/collect/ImmutableSet java/util/Spliterator? a b??????? l 3com/google/common/collect/RegularImmutableSortedSet p, ?? p? java/lang/Comparable ? ???? ?? ? ? ? ? ? ? ? 4com/google/common/collect/ImmutableSortedSet$Builder ? ???? q?? ?? ?? ,com/google/common/collect/ImmutableSortedSet????? Q? ???? i j??????? ?????? ? ? Q R ? ? ?? ? ? ? ? ? ??? ? ? ? ? ? ? ?????? ? ??? ? 'java/lang/UnsupportedOperationException U V q .com/google/common/collect/ImmutableSortedSet$1?? ?? java/io/InvalidObjectException Use SerializedForm ?? ;com/google/common/collect/ImmutableSortedSet$SerializedForm?? ??+, ? ? ? ? ? ? U q 4com/google/common/collect/ImmutableSet$CachingAsList java/util/NavigableSet (com/google/common/collect/SortedIterable java/util/Comparator 'com/google/common/collect/ImmutableList +com/google/common/collect/CollectCollectors "com/google/common/collect/Ordering natural &()Lcom/google/common/collect/Ordering; java/lang/Object equals (Ljava/lang/Object;)Z NATURAL_EMPTY_SET B(Lcom/google/common/collect/ImmutableList;Ljava/util/Comparator;)V =(Ljava/lang/Object;)Lcom/google/common/collect/ImmutableList; java/lang/System arraycopy *(Ljava/lang/Object;ILjava/lang/Object;II)V clone addAll L(Ljava/util/Iterator;)Lcom/google/common/collect/ImmutableSortedSet$Builder; build $com/google/common/base/Preconditions checkNotNull )com/google/common/collect/SortedIterables -(Ljava/util/Comparator;Ljava/lang/Iterable;)Z
isPartialView ()Z #com/google/common/collect/Iterables toArray )(Ljava/lang/Iterable;)[Ljava/lang/Object; -(Ljava/util/SortedSet;)Ljava/util/Comparator; A(Ljava/util/Collection;)Lcom/google/common/collect/ImmutableList; isEmpty &com/google/common/collect/ObjectArrays checkElementsNotNull )([Ljava/lang/Object;I)[Ljava/lang/Object; java/util/Arrays sort .([Ljava/lang/Object;IILjava/util/Comparator;)V compare fill *([Ljava/lang/Object;IILjava/lang/Object;)V asImmutableList ?([Ljava/lang/Object;I)Lcom/google/common/collect/ImmutableList; java/util/Collections ()V
checkArgument (Z)V #com/google/common/collect/Iterators getNext :(Ljava/util/Iterator;Ljava/lang/Object;)Ljava/lang/Object; getFirst :(Ljava/lang/Iterable;Ljava/lang/Object;)Ljava/lang/Object; .com/google/common/collect/UnmodifiableIterator next size ()I 3(Lcom/google/common/collect/ImmutableSortedSet;JI)V (Ljava/lang/String;)V ()[Ljava/lang/Object; ,(Ljava/util/Comparator;[Ljava/lang/Object;)V! G H I M N O P ? Q R S T ? U V S W X
Y Z [ \ ] ^ O _ F a b c A *? ? d S e Q R f Q T g Q S h i j c ? ? *? ? ? L+?? Y? *? ? d W
Y [ ] e k l Q R f k m Q T n g Q S o p q c ? ? d h S r p s c K ? Y*?
? ? ? d m e t u f t v g t S w p x c d ? ? Y*SY+S? ? d x e t u y u f t v y v g t y S z p { c | ? ? Y*SY+SY,S? ? d ? e t u y u | u f t v y v | v g
t y | S } p ~ c ? ? ? Y*SY+SY,SY-S? ? d ? e * t u y u | u u f * t v y v | v v g t y | S ? p ? c ? !? ? Y*SY+SY,SY-SYS? ? d ? e 4 ! t u ! y u ! | u ! u ! ? u f 4 ! t v ! y v ! | v ! v ! ? v g t y | ? S ? ? p ? c , D?`? :*S+S,S-SSS??
? ?? ? d &